Madagascar Prepares to Launch Nationwide Mandatory E-Invoicing in 2025

Madagascar is steadily advancing its plans to implement mandatory electronic invoicing as part of broader tax system reforms. A centralized e-invoicing platform is currently under development, with the government aiming for full implementation in 2025.

Legal Basis and Timeline for Implementation

Under the provisions of the 2024 Amended Finance Law (Draft Law No. 012/2024, adopted in June 2024), Madagascar formally initiated the creation of an online invoicing module designed to support a standardized and structured national e-invoicing system. This centralized platform is intended to ensure real-time access to transactional data while reducing VAT fraud.

The upcoming framework will apply across all sectors and economic transactions within the country, making electronic invoicing mandatory for all businesses and taxpayers. While the authorities have not yet published a definitive implementation date, it is expected during 2025, following the completion of necessary technical and regulatory preparations.

Objectives and Scope of the E-Invoicing System

  • Enhancing Tax Revenue Control: The system will support more accurate and timely revenue tracking by confirming the correctness of tax filings and sales data.
  • Combating Tax Fraud: Recording invoices in a centralized digital platform will reduce opportunities for fraud and improve auditability.
  • Reducing Compliance Burdens: Electronic processes are expected to streamline obligations for both taxpayers and the tax authority, cutting administrative costs and increasing efficiency.
  • Full Operational Coverage: The new framework will cover all types of transactions-B2B, B2C, and B2G-regardless of company size or industry, ensuring full integration across Madagascar’s economy.

This comprehensive initiative reflects the government’s commitment to building a modern, transparent fiscal infrastructure. The centralized system will enhance the Direction Générale des Impôts (DGI) capacity to oversee tax obligations while providing businesses with a reliable and streamlined compliance tool.
